Saltar al contenido principal

Enlace de Trámites

Vista General

Este módulo permite gestionar y vincular documentos externos o trámites que no están registrados en el sistema de correspondencia principal (SISCOR). Es útil para mantener un registro de documentación relacionada que ingresa por otros medios o que necesita ser enlazada a trámites existentes.

Tablero Principal de Enlaces

El tablero muestra un listado de los documentos/trámites enlazados.

Estructura de la Tabla de Enlaces:

CampoDescripción
IDIdentificador único del enlace
Fecha NotaFecha del documento original
CiteNúmero de cite del documento
EntidadEntidad o institución de origen
InstituciónNombre completo de la institución
DestinatarioPersona o cargo destinatario
ReferenciaAsunto o tema del documento
Fecha EntidadFecha del documento en la entidad de origen
EstadoEstado del enlace (Activo/Inactivo)

Gestión de Archivos Adjuntos

Subir Archivos

Cada enlace puede tener múltiples archivos adjuntos.

Ruta: admin/enlaces/{enlace}/file

Campos del Formulario de Archivo:

CampoDescripción
ArchivosSelector de archivos desde el equipo

Proceso de Adjuntar Archivos:

  1. Acceder al detalle de un enlace
  2. Hacer clic en el botón para agregar archivos
  3. Seleccionar uno o múltiples archivos desde el equipo
  4. Confirmar la carga
  5. Los archivos se almacenarán en: storage/app/public/entradas/{mes}/{año}/{nombre_archivo}

Eliminación de Archivos

Los archivos adjuntos pueden ser eliminados (eliminación lógica):

  • Se guarda el usuario que eliminó el archivo
  • Se registra la fecha de eliminación
  • El archivo ya no aparece en el listado activo

Modelo de Datos

Tabla: enlaces

CampoTipoDescripción
idBigIntIdentificador único
fechaNotaDateFecha del documento
citeStringNúmero de cite
entidadStringEntidad de origen
institucionStringNombre de institución
destinatarioStringPersona destinataria
referenciaTextAsunto del documento
fechaEntidadDateFecha en la entidad
statusBooleanEstado activo/inactivo
registerUser_idBigIntUsuario que registró
deleted_atDatetimeFecha de eliminación
deleteUser_idBigIntUsuario que eliminó

Tabla: enlace_files

CampoTipoDescripción
idBigIntIdentificador único
nombre_origenStringNombre original del archivo
enlace_idBigIntID del enlace padre
rutaStringRuta de almacenamiento
registerUser_idBigIntUsuario que subió el archivo
deleted_atDatetimeFecha de eliminación
deleteUser_idBigIntUsuario que eliminó

Casos de Uso

1. Documentos que ingresan por Courier Externo

Cuando documentos llegan por servicios de courier que no pasan por registro normal.

2. Documentos de Otras Instituciones

Registrar documentación que llega de otras entidades gubernamentales.

3. Seguimiento de Trámites Externos

Mantener registro de trámites que se realizan fuera del sistema principal.

4. Adjuntos Adicionales

Agregar documentación adicional a trámites ya registrados.

Consideraciones

  • Este módulo es complementario al sistema de correspondencia principal
  • Permite mantener trazabilidad de documentos que de otra forma no quedarían registrados
  • Los archivos se almacenan en el storage del sistema con organización por fecha
  • Se mantiene historial de quién subió y quién eliminó archivos
  • Es útil para casos donde el documento físico llega pero no se registra en el flujo normal